For our last meal in Chicago, we decided to go with Middle Eastern food. The restaurant is beautiful, with warm wood everywhere that makes the whole space feel cozy and inviting. Menu at the end. Average spend was around $35 per person. 👉 Chickpea Hummus with Soft Egg ⭐️⭐️⭐️⭐️⭐️ ($26) So, so good. The hummus was incredibly smooth and creamy without being overly thick or heavy. It had such a clean, pure chickpea flavor. The chili oil on top was fragrant rather than spicy, and the soft pita was perfect for scooping everything up. Even eating the hummus by itself wasn’t too salty. Two pitas and one order of hummus felt like the perfect appetizer to share among three people. 👉 Grilled Shrimp ($20) I don’t eat shrimp, so I can’t really comment on the taste, but they looked impressively large. The shrimp came over a creamy corn porridge-like base with a buttery texture, topped with a fragrant, mild chili oil that wasn’t spicy at all. 👉 Shakshuka ⭐️⭐️⭐️⭐️ ($22) Such a pure tomato flavor. Oddly enough, it reminded me of the tomato sauce from the steak restaurants I went to as a kid. Tomatoes and runny eggs are one of those combinations that are almost impossible to get wrong, and dipping the sourdough into the sauce made it even better. Simple, comforting, and very satisfying. 👉 Orange Rhubarb Frozen Yogurt ⭐️⭐️⭐️⭐️ ($6) It really does taste like frozen yogurt. I wasn’t getting many orange or rhubarb notes—it was mostly just a straightforward frozen yogurt flavor. Thankfully, it wasn’t overly sweet, which I really appreciated. Simple, refreshing, and a nice way to end the meal.

Avec is a long, narrow room with communal cedar-wood tables, exposed beams, and a warmth that comes from both the wood-burning oven doing most of the cooking and the general density of people who are clearly happy to be there. It's been on West Randolph since 2003 and remains one of the best reasons to eat on Restaurant Row. The format is Mediterranean-leaning small plates and the philosophy is straightforward: very good ingredients, handled well, shared generously. The chorizo-stuffed Medjool dates are the dish that built this restaurant's reputation and they've been on the menu for twenty-plus years because nobody has figured out a reason to take them off. Fat dates stuffed with spicy-sweet chorizo, wrapped in bacon and crisped in the wood oven, served on a warm piquillo pepper-tomato sauce. They're salty and sweet and a little smoky all at once and the sauce underneath ties everything together with an acidity that makes the whole thing feel lighter than it has any right to. Order more than you think you need. We also had the potato and salted cod brandade, a creamy, garlicky spread served warm with crostini that could easily become the thing you return for on its own. The short rib hummus, braised short rib piled over good hummus, is the other dish that keeps showing up at every table. Between these three things and a couple of glasses from the strong wine list, a full and genuinely satisfying dinner assembles itself without any effort at all. Tuesday nights are half-price bottles, which is worth knowing. Service is fast and knowledgeable and doesn't waste time. The communal tables mean you're occasionally seated close to strangers, which some people love and others don't. Either way it's part of what gives the room its particular energy.

Was able to taste a ton of the great food here with my group - this place slaps. There were no misses on the dinner part. All 8 or so dishes we had were at worst great and at best spectacular. All very bold and punchy flavors if Mediterranean fare. My favorites were some of their specials - the bacon wrapped dates and the pork shoulder. Chicken shawarma was also an insanely good value option. We also loved the steak even though it was small. I love loved their hummus, but would actually go for the normal hummus over the short rib option - it’s less than half the price and better value. The only miss of dinner was the burnt honey chocolate pie dessert. I thought this was actively bad and definitely a bummer to end on when the rest of the food was so good! Cocktails in here were excellent as well. More focused on Mediterranean flavors of course - with some options having cumin and similar spices added. Fairly priced, but not a deal or overly expensive. Vibe in here is great - there are 2 floors. 1st floor is much better vibes, but second floor is okay too. Absolutely come here if you have the time and have the money to spend! My group of 5 paid about $80 a person with one drink each and that included tip. 4.5/5.
